Renting 45ft Containers: A Comprehensive Guide

Worldwide of logistics and shipping, the effective and affordable transport of items is critical. One of the most flexible tools in this market is the 45-foot container, which uses a larger capacity than basic 20 and 40-foot containers. This article explores the intricacies of leasing 45ft containers, providing vital info for businesses and people wanting to optimize their shipping procedures.

20ft-green-high-cube-1-2.jpg

Understanding 45ft Containers

A 45-foot container, frequently described as a high cube container, is a basic intermodal container that measures 45 ft storage container feet in length, 8 feet in width, and 9 feet 6 inches in height. These dimensions supply a significant volume of 3060 cubic feet, making it ideal for large deliveries. Unlike the 20 and 40-foot containers, the 45-foot container offers an extra 5 feet in length and 6 inches in height, translating to more space and better utilization of cargo.

Advantages of Renting 45ft Containers

  1. Increased Capacity: The additional space permits more goods to be delivered in a single container, reducing the number of containers required and potentially reducing total shipping expenses.
  2. Cost Efficiency: For big shipments, renting a 45ft container can be more economical than using multiple smaller sized containers.
  3. Versatility: Renting provides the flexibility to adjust to varying shipping requirements without the commitment of purchasing a container.
  4. Resilience: High-quality 45ft containers are built to withstand the rigors of long-distance transport, guaranteeing the security and stability of the cargo.
  5. Reduce of Use: Containers are created for easy loading and discharging, simplifying the shipping process.

Applications of 45ft Containers

45-foot containers are widely used in numerous industries for different functions:

  • Retail and E-commerce: Ideal for large deliveries of durable goods, making it much easier to handle inventory and distribution.
  • Production: Perfect for carrying basic materials and finished products in bulk.
  • Building and construction: Useful for moving heavy and large construction materials.
  • Military and Government: Suited for massive logistics operations and disaster relief efforts.
  • Farming: Great for shipping agricultural items and devices.

How to Rent a 45ft Container

Leasing a 45ft container involves a number of steps to ensure a smooth and efficient procedure:

  1. Determine Your Needs:

    • Volume of Goods: Calculate the total volume of your cargo to determine if a 45ft container is needed.
    • Shipping Route: Consider the range and mode of transportation (sea, rail, or roadway) to choose the best container.
    • Duration: Decide how long you need the container, whether for a single shipment or a longer-term lease.
  2. Research Study Rental Providers:

    • Reputation: Look for service providers with a great performance history and positive client reviews.
    • Providers Offered: Check if the company uses extra services such as delivery, pickup, and upkeep.
    • Cost: Compare rates and extra fees to discover the most cost-efficient alternative.
  3. Pick the Type of Container:

    • Standard: Suitable for the majority of dry products.
    • Cooled: For temperature-sensitive products like food and pharmaceuticals.
    • Open Top: Useful for large or heavy cargo that needs top loading.
    • Flat Rack: Ideal for products that require to be packed from the side or top.
  4. Work out the Terms:

    • Lease Duration: Agree on the length of the lease, whether it's short-term or long-lasting.
    • Pickup and Delivery: Clarify the logistics of getting and delivering the container.
    • Condition: Ensure the container remains in good condition before and after usage to prevent extra charges.
  5. Sign the Contract:

    • Read Carefully: Review the contract to understand all conditions.
    • Insurance: Consider purchasing insurance coverage to safeguard your cargo throughout transit.
    • Payment: Agree on the payment technique and schedule.
  6. Prepare for Shipment:

    • Packing: Ensure your cargo is jam-packed firmly to prevent damage throughout transportation.
    • Paperwork: Prepare all essential shipping files, consisting of bills of lading and customizeds declarations.
    • Logistics: Coordinate with the shipping company to set up the transportation.

Tips for Efficient Container Rental

  • Pre-Planning: Plan your shipment in advance to prevent last-minute complications.
  • Regular Maintenance: Keep the container in excellent condition by following the provider's upkeep standards.
  • Appropriate Loading: Load the container evenly to guarantee stability and safety during transport.
  • Security Measures: Implement security steps such as locks and seals to safeguard your cargo.
  • Environmental Considerations: Choose environment-friendly alternatives and practices to lower your carbon footprint.

Frequently Asked Questions About Renting 45ft Containers

Q: What is the distinction between a 45-foot container and a 40-foot container?

  • A: A 45-foot container is 5 feet longer and 6 inches taller than a 40-foot container, supplying an extra 530 cubic feet of area. This extra area can be essential for large deliveries.

Q: How much does it cost to Rent 45ft containers a 45ft container?

  • A: The cost of renting a 45ft container varies based on elements such as duration, place, and kind of container. Typically, you can expect to pay between ₤ 2,000 to ₤ 3,500 per month for a basic 45ft container.

Q: Can 45ft containers be used for long-term storage?

  • A: Yes, 45ft containers can be used for long-lasting storage. However, it's important to make sure the container is stored in a safe and secure and weather-protected area to keep its condition.

Q: What are the weight limits for a 45ft container?

  • A: The maximum gross weight for a 45ft container specifications container is typically around 67,200 pounds (30,480 kg), with an optimum payload of about 59,500 pounds (27,000 kg). These limits can differ depending on the specific container and the shipping company's guidelines.

Q: What types of products are best matched for 45ft containers?

  • A: 45ft containers are perfect for big volumes of dry items, temperature-sensitive items, and bulky or heavy materials. They are typically used in retail, manufacturing, construction, and farming.

Q: How do I make sure the container remains in great condition before and after usage?

  • A: Inspect the container completely before and after use to ensure it meets the needed requirements. File any damages or concerns and report them to the rental provider to avoid disputes.

Q: Can I customize a 45ft container for specific requirements?

  • A: Yes, numerous rental service providers use modification options such as adding windows, doors, or reinforcing the structure. Nevertheless, this might come at an additional cost and must be gone over during the rental settlement.

Q: What are the environmental impacts of utilizing 45ft containers?
